What’s Wrong with Traditional Solutions?

Many times, folks in the poultry industry tend to grab the first solution thrown at them. You know, that moment when you just want to get it all sorted? Well, standard manure handling often falls short. Whether it’s pumping, storing, or simply spreading, the inefficiencies can lead to odors, nutrient loss, and even environmental hazards; not exactly ideal for anyone. People tend to forget that not all fermentation tanks are created equal. Just because it looks cool doesn’t mean it functions well (trust me, I’ve seen a few duds in my time). It’s crucial to understand how a well-designed fermentation tank can boost nutrient retention and minimize unpleasant smells, preventing these common mishaps.

Key Lessons to Consider Before Deciding

From my experience in the field, I’ve learned the hard way that not all technology is created equal. If you’re out shopping for a fermentation tank, here are three evaluation metrics I’d suggest focusing on: first, check the tank’s capacity—more could mean less handling; second, assess the customization options—some tanks can be tailored to fit your specific needs, and third, look at after-sales support—nothing worse than buying a tank and then being left hanging when troubleshooting. I’ve been there, and it’s frustrating! With adequate research and understanding, you can easily avoid those pitfalls and invest wisely.
